Rajkot Youth Stabbed To Death By Three Over Illicit Affair Suspicion, Police Arrest Two

Rajkot: A 20-year-old man was brutally murdered on Monday night in Rajkot’s Bapunagar area in what police suspect was a fallout of a personal dispute over an alleged romantic relationship. The deceased, Jeeshan Kasvani, was attacked in the slum quarters around 9 PM and succumbed to his injuries shortly after being rushed to the hospital.
According to officials, Jeeshan was confronted by three men, identified as Aman Mehbub Chauhan, Afzal Sikandar Juneja, and an unidentified third person. The group engaged in a heated argument, which quickly escalated into violence. Witnesses say Jeeshan was first assaulted and then stabbed in the abdomen. His cries for help drew the attention of nearby residents, but the attackers fled before anyone could intervene.
Jeeshan, who worked at a food cart on Bapunagar Main Road, was taken to a government hospital but was declared dead during treatment. His sudden death has left his family devastated. Police launched an immediate investigation. Teams from Bhaktinagar Police Station, Local Crime Branch (LCB) Zone-1, and the Crime Branch reached the scene soon after the incident. Within hours, two of the suspects were arrested. Search operations are ongoing to track down the third accused.
Preliminary investigation points to a personal motive. Sources within the police revealed that Aman Chauhan, one of the arrested men, had recently married. He allegedly suspected that Jeeshan was having an affair with his wife. This suspicion, authorities believe, may have led to the fatal confrontation.
The body has been sent for post-mortem, and statements from witnesses and family members are being recorded. The police are also examining CCTV footage from the surrounding area to trace the movement of the accused before and after the attack.
